In order to achieve more sustainability and climate protection as well as a higher quality of life, mobility and transport must also be transformed, infrastructure must be adapted and the mobility offer in cities and in rural areas must be expanded. Municipal transport and urban planning as well as innovations for public transport have a decisive influence on whether this change can be successfully shaped and mobility guaranteed. The contribution of motor vehicle transport to achieving the climate targets can mainly be achieved through a transition of drive systems and energy sources. Municipalities play a pivotal role in the development of the charging infrastructure. Redesigns of public space and changes in mobility behaviour can succeed better through social exchange, intensive communication and transparent participation processes.

The ADAC expert series 2023 “Transforming transport. Remaining mobile. Sustainable concepts for communities that move everyone.” (“Verkehr wandeln. Mobil bleiben. Zukunftsfähige Konzepte für Kommunen, die alle bewegen.”) will give information on pioneering concepts in the context of the transport system of tomorrow.

Seven face-to-face events being held between March and July will offer the opportunity for professional and personal exchange. In autumn, an additional online final event will be held. NOW and the National Centre for Charging Infrastructure will be represented at the following events:
